Lernen: Definition - "Lernen" in Capital Markets: "Lernen" in the context of capital markets refers to the process of acquiring knowledge and understanding of various financial instruments, investment strategies, market trends, and fundamental analysis techniques. It encompasses the continuous pursuit of education and skill development to improve investment decision-making and performance. In German, "Lernen" translates to "learning" in English and highlights the importance of ongoing education and knowledge advancement in the highly dynamic and complex world of capital markets. Investors engage in "Lernen" to enhance their proficiency in evaluating investment opportunities, managing risks, and optimizing investment returns. This includes familiarizing themselves with the fundamentals of stock markets, loans, bonds, money markets, and cryptocurrencies. Understanding the intricacies of stocks is crucial for investors. It involves studying the underlying businesses, analyzing financial statements, evaluating valuation metrics, and assessing market trends. By staying informed about the company's financial health, growth prospects, and industry dynamics, investors can make better-informed investment decisions. When it comes to loans and bonds, "Lernen" involves comprehending the nuances of fixed income securities, credit ratings, yield-to-maturity calculations, and the impact of interest rate changes on bond prices. This knowledge helps investors assess the creditworthiness of issuers and determine the risk-return trade-offs associated with different fixed income assets. In money markets, "Lernen" focuses on understanding short-term debt instruments such as treasury bills, commercial paper, and certificates of deposit. Knowledge of money market instruments helps investors manage their liquidity needs, optimize cash flows, and make informed choices based on prevailing interest rates and credit risks. The emergence of cryptocurrencies has added a new dimension to capital markets. "Lernen" in cryptocurrencies includes understanding blockchain technology, digital wallets, private and public keys, and the risks associated with this relatively nascent asset class. Deepening knowledge about cryptocurrencies helps investors evaluate their potential as alternative investments and navigate the evolving regulatory landscape surrounding virtual currencies.
